I don't worry about online purchases anymore. I just cancelled the card I had been using for online purchases and got a new one that I only use offline and in person. For internet purchases I started using www.Privacy.com.

Every single online vendor gets a virtual VISA locked exclusively to them, with spending limits based on my current purchases. Any transaction attempt that I didn't explicitly authorize just gets declined, and none of the virtual card numbers even link back to my main card.

Privacy.com puts the control you have with physical cash into the internet. Works with free trials too. Open a new card, start a trial, cancel the card immediately. No need to worry about cancelling the service because the card is closed, lmao.

The real problem is that humans make errors and, because of that, anybody can be hacked.

Common oversights that are preventable range from something as stupid as not changing the default admin passwords or leaking keys to someone social engineering themselves into an admin account.

And sometimes developers are just incompetent.
